SB0096 : V4.9.2 Service Release for all Vi1, 2, 4 & 6 consoles Now Available! ============================================================================= This is to announce the availability of service release V4.9.2.306 for all Vi1, 2, 4 & 6 consoles. This release provides support for MSBi Stageboxes on the original Vi range, plus fixes to issues reported since V4.9.1 was released. In order to ensure maximum stability, we recommend that this software is installed into all Vi1, 2, 4 & 6 consoles as soon as possible. Bug Fixes / Improvements ------------------------ • MSBi Stageboxes are now supported (output cards were not showing up correctly on Vi consoles). • Vi1 could restart if two shows containing certain MIDI events were loaded sequentially. • MIDI Channel Selection could change from “IN1: CH1” to “NO DEVICE” after deleting Cues • Vi1 ViSi Remote: L and R master faders are now linked as they are on the console, to prevent accidental L-R level offsets. Note that the V4.9.2 software update cannot be installed on Vix00/x000 series consoles. The current V6.4.1 software release for these consoles is available from the Soundcraft website. Update Instructions ------------------- Vi2, 4 & 6 Please note that for Vi2/4/6, when upgrading to software 4.9.0 and above, the DSP and FX cards within the Local Rack must be fitted in the correct slots in order for audio to function correctly. On software versions pre-4.9.0, this did not matter, and might have allowed cards fitted in non-factory default locations to go undetected. Check the locations of your DSP and FX cards before performing the 4.9.2 update by referring to the Update Instructions document. A document ‘Checking DSP card positions in Vi Local Racks’ is also available from the website. Vi1 Note that Vi1 consoles use a hibernation process to allow a fast boot, this means that a specific procedure has to be followed carefully when doing a software update.
